The retention sweeper in the Cobbleworth platform runs nightly and purges records older than each tenant's configured window. New team members should note that the sweeper exposes a dry-run endpoint, which reports what would be deleted without touching data; always dry-run before changing a tenant's policy. Sweeps are idempotent, so re-running after a partial failure is safe. Deletion events are written to the audit stream for ninety days. All sweeper endpoints require authentication with the bearer token below.

login token, bagug-kafop: eyJhbGciOiJIUzI1NiIsInR5cCI6IkpXVCJ9.eyJzdWIiOiIcMLov2In0.Z5RLDIfp

At Quillbridge, every schema migration bundle is signed before the orchestrator will apply it. This matters for zero-downtime rollouts: the expand phase and the contract phase ship as separate signed artifacts, and the orchestrator refuses to run the contract step unless the expand artifact's signature was verified on every replica. As release manager, you are responsible for signing both bundles and confirming verification in the dashboard before traffic shifts. Signing is done with the release key shown below.

rollout seal: bky4_x7Gc

### Step 2: Migrate your tailer profiles

The new version of `logreel`, our internal log-tailing CLI, stores saved tail profiles in a shared Postgres table instead of local YAML files. Run `logreel profiles import` to copy your existing profiles into the shared store. Before running the import, set the `LOGREEL_STORE` environment variable so the CLI knows where to write — it expects the connection string below.

primary connection of yagep-kahip = redis://giliel_svc:zYiKsLL2PLpfPL@db-348f.xolmarsys.corp:5432/fenwyn